Thermally induced current in low noise polymeric coaxial cables can introduce significant errors in certain applications. For e-beam crosslinked polymeric cable, the thermally induced current signal can be as high as 1 nA/m. The origin of such thermally induced signals is explained, based on the change of morphology and dielectric polarization as a function of temperature. The results of measurements carried out on three types of cables over a wide range of temperature are in good agreement with numerical simulations which involve the nonlinear thermal properties of the cable materials  相似文献

空间电荷现象严重制约着高压直流塑料电缆的发展。目前,脉冲电声法(pulse electric acoustic,PEA)是国际上常用的测量固体电介质中空间电荷分布的非破坏性的方法之一。首先从高压脉冲的注入方式出发,简述了几种基于PEA法的同轴塑料电缆空间电荷测量技术;同时,提出了一种基于高压脉冲从测量电极注入电缆试样的改进测量装置,在该装置中通过蓄电池、环氧底座以及光电转换器等将采集数据的示波器进行对地隔离,从而提高了测量系统测量信号的频带宽度;然后,介绍了同轴塑料电缆空间电荷波形的恢复方法;最后,概述了空间电荷测量技术在评估电力电缆老化程度中的应用和未来在线测量空间电荷的可行性及发展方向。  相似文献

EMP作用下的电缆耦合及屏蔽效能试验分析   总被引:1,自引:0,他引:1  
介绍了三同轴法、线注入法、功率吸收钳法、混波室法等电缆屏蔽效能测试方法.进行了电磁脉冲作用下的同轴电缆和裸线耦合试验,探讨了该环境下同轴电缆屏蔽效能的测试方法.试验分析表明,电缆耦合后的波形为衰减振荡波,振荡周期正比于电缆的电长度,频谱与照射场的频谱不一致,裸线的耦合输出衰减较快.根据试验数据,采用峰值场强法计算的电缆屏蔽效能与峰值电压法的结果吻合,所以可采用峰值场强法对电缆进行电磁脉冲的屏蔽效能测试.电磁脉冲作用下的同轴电缆屏蔽效能较相当频段连续波作用下的略低.  相似文献

Water treeing is one of the factors leading to failure of medium voltage XLPE cables in long-term service. Increased moisture content inside oil-paper insulated cable is not desirable. To identify water tree degraded XLPE cables or oil-paper cables with high moisture content, diagnostic tests based on dielectric response (DR) measurement in time and frequency domain are used. Review of individual DR measurement techniques in the time and frequency domains indicates that measurement of one parameter in either domain may not be sufficient to reveal the status of the cable insulation. But a combination of several DR parameters can improve diagnostic results with respect to water trees present in XLPE cables or increased moisture content in oil-paper cables. DR measurement is a very useful tool that reveals average condition of cable systems. However, it is unlikely that DR measurement will detect few, but long water trees. In addition, DR cannot locate the defect or water tree site within the cable system. Combination of DR and partial discharge (PD) measurements can improve diagnostic results with respect to global and local defects. However, it is doubtful whether PD test can identify the presence of water trees inside a cable in a nondestructive manner. Further research is needed for more detailed conclusions regarding the status of a particular insulation and for predicting the remaining life of the insulation system.  相似文献

With a view to develop a new water tree suppressive XLPE cable, the authors have investigated the effect of introducing polar groups into crosslinked polyethylene (XLPE) dielectrics. An aliphatic carboxylic acid derivative was found to be the best additive as a water tree suppressor. New cables insulated with XLPE dielectrics containing this aliphatic carboxylic acid derivative were developed. It was confirmed that the cables, having the same physical and electrical properties as those of conventional XLPE cables, showed an excellent water tree suppressive effect and long term performance.  相似文献

The frequency-dependent resistances and inductances of cables can either be found from analyt ical formulas, or with numerical methods based on finite elements or subdivision of conductors. While analytical formulas are limited to coaxial configurations, numerical methods can be used for non-concentric configurations as well. This paper discusses the method of subdivision into subconductors of circular, square or elemental shape, and compares the results for the case of a coaxial cable, where exact solutions are available from analytical formulas. The inclusion of ground return impedances is discussed next. The method is then applied to the calculation of impedances of pipe-type cables with magnetic pipe material, and of internal impedances of stranded conductors in the power line carrier frequency range.  相似文献

以同轴电极中填充电导率或相对介电常数为非线性绝缘介质所构成的绝缘结构作为主要研究对象,分别仿真分析了在阶跃电压作用下非线性绝缘介质内瞬态电场分布.采用电场模拟软件ElecNet的瞬态2D求解器对同轴电极中填充非线性绝缘介质所构成的绝缘结构进行瞬态仿真分析.结果表明:相对介电常数非线性的绝缘介质只在初始状态时起到均化电场作用,稳态时绝缘利用系数较小;电导率和相对介电常数均为非线性绝缘介质,在整个过程中都能起到均化电场作用,改善电场的效果最好.  相似文献

The high frequency properties of coaxial power cables are modeled using time- and frequency-domain numerical simulations. This is required due to the complex helical structure of the outer metallic screen. The finite element (FEM) and finite difference time domain methods (FDTD) have been employed to study the effect of screen spiralization. It is established that this screen design causes a dependence of the cable high frequency characteristics on the surrounding medium. Analytical model based on modal analysis of wave propagation in coaxial cables confirms the numerical observations  相似文献

XLPE电缆局放脉冲频谱分析及传感器选频   总被引:2,自引:1,他引:2  
为选择好局放测量传感器的频带,用指数衰减函数、梯形函数、高斯函数和三角函数数学描述了交联聚乙烯(XLPE)电缆中的局放脉冲并定量分析了局放脉冲的上限频率,其结果和实测局放脉冲经快速付里叶变换后的频谱基本吻合。用最小二乘法拟合信号各频率分量在XLPE电缆中的三特性并给出最优表达式后,把输出信号和输入信号比值在0.7~1范围内作为局放能量的集中区域,在此区域内得到检测不同长度XLPE电缆局放所需传感器的频带要求。对于5m长的电缆接头,传感器上限频率需>168.9MHz,较长电缆局放测量则需数十MHz。  相似文献

Pyroelectricity is the electrical response of a material to a change in temperature. It exists in polymers which contain spontaneous or frozen polarization resulting from oriented dipoles. This review describes the physical basis for the existence of the pyroelectric effect and discusses its behavior in a number of amorphous, semicrystalline, crystalline and liquid crystalline polymers. Some of the techniques for measurement of the pyroelectric effect are presented and its use in pyroelectric relaxation spectroscopy and thermal analysis is described. The spatial distribution of polarization and space charge through the thickness of polymer films can be determined by several thermal pyroelectric techniques. Recent developments in the integration of pyroelectric polymer infrared detectors with solid-state silicon devices are described. One of the most important recent applications of polymers is in photopyroelectric spectroscopy which can be used for the determination of a number of thermal and optical properties of materials. Finally, some miscellaneous applications in physics, chemistry and biology are presented  相似文献

This paper reports the results from the condition assessment of 12- and 24-kV cross-linked polyethylene (XPLE) cables using a technique based on dielectric spectroscopy initially developed at KTH in Sweden. The work aims to examine whether the method could detect water tree degradation for the second generation medium voltage (MV) cables with long, but not bridging, water trees. While the overall cable condition was better than expected for second generation XPLE cables, water trees were found in most of the selected cables. The diagnostic method based on the measurement of the dielectric response could only detect water tree degradation in the examined second generation cables when the water trees bridged the insulation wall. Condition assessment above service stress may, in some cases, be required to detect bridging water trees. The results indicate that there is a correlation between the voltage level and the breakdown voltage of the cable. This can be used as a diagnostic criterion for this group of cables.  相似文献
